Osterley Station (GPS: 51.48102, -0.35196) is a station of the London Underground in Osterley, in the London Borough of Hounslow. The station building is located on Great West Road, near Osterley Park, and is in Travelcard Zone 4. It is served by the Heathrow branch of the Piccadilly Line between the Boston Manor Tube Station (heading towards Cockfosters Tube Station) and Hounslow East Tube Station (heading towards Heathrow Airport Terminals 4 or 5).

The Osterley Tube Station started operating in 1934. It was designed in the modern European style by Stanley Heaps. The station was originally served by the District Line as well, until it pulled out of services here in 1964.

The H91 is the London Bus route serving this station.
